P.S. why does it make sense for us (comair) to go ATL-ABE-ATL, why ASA goes CVG-ABE-CVG...I msut be missing something.


It makes perfect sense from Delta's perspective. Strike protection. You guys can keep working that flight and give some service to ABE from ATL and it will not be flying struck work. Delta learned this the hard way after you guys went on strike. This is exactly why there is so many DCI carriers in ATL.

P.S. why does it make sense for us (comair) to go ATL-ABE-ATL, why ASA goes CVG-ABE-CVG...I msut be missing something.

It makes no sense at all. Even worse is when Comair will do something like CVG-ABE-ATL and then do a few out and backs from ATL while ASA does ATL-ABE-CVG and does a few out and backs from CVG. If weather hits CVG Comair is delayed to ABE and is late for the rest of the day while ASA is delayed to CVG and is delayed the rest of the day. This would be the inverse if weather hit ATL, but the result, of two late aircraft, is the same.

The simple solution is to leave Comair in CVG and ASA in ATL, then when weather hits one hub only one aircraft is delayed. If an aircraft were built using this logic a taxi light would burn out and you'd have to do a single engine approach.
